quinta-feira, 12 de setembro de 2013

Meus queridos leitores,  hoje falaremos sobre o PHP (Hypertext Preprocessor). 

Tenham boa leitura!

O que é PHP?

PHP é uma linguagem de programação criada com a intenção de juntar os programas PERL (linguagem programação voltada para a criação de programas de interface no computador) e CGI (linguagem de criação de páginas dinâmicas que permitem que um servidor aloje informações na Web, possibilitando os futuros acessos). Para que ele funcione é necessário o uso de um servidor próprio como o APACHE, EASYPHP, XAMP e outros.

Para quê serve o PHP e quais suas vantagens?

Sendo um programa muito versátil, podemos utilizá-lo para quase qualquer coisa. Normalmente sua utilização encontra-se na criação de formulários, páginas dinâmicas e para mandar e receber cookies.  Devido a facilidade de utilização dos códigos PHP, muitas vezes eles são tidos como adendos para códigos HTML de modo a facilitar a programação para o programador.
As notáveis vantagens de se usar o PHP encontram-se em:

1º - Métodos de envio seguro dando ao programador o poder de escolher a exibição de dados no navegador ou não, utilizando os seguintes códigos: POST (método de envio invisível. Com este comando, amenos que o usuário tenha vasto conhecimento em PHP ele não terá acesso ao que se está transmitindo. Recomendado para senha e afins) GUETH (método de envio visível. Com este método qualquer usuário pode ver e ter acesso aos dados transmitidos no navegador. Recomendo para fóruns e afins).

2º - Segurança nos códigos. No nosso querido PHP, os códigos inseridos para exibição da página não são revelados quando se opta por exibir o código fonte da página (mesmo sem a opção POST. Quando se opta por usar o PHP como adendo do HTML o primeiro mantem seus códigos seguros exibindo apenas os códigos do primeiro).Por esse motivo ele muitas vezes é utilizado na criação de jogos já que seu código apenas é exibido para quem possui o servidor utilizado em sua criação.

3º - Facilidade de utilização dos códigos. Mesmo em grandes tarefas os códigos PHP são bem reduzidos e algumas de suas funcionalidades podem ser definidas na barra de tarefas dos editores de páginas Web, como o Dreamweaver.


Veja a seguir alguns códigos PHP:



quarta-feira, 11 de setembro de 2013

HTML (Continuação)

Como prometido viemos mostrar um pouco mais do HTML para vocês. Nessa postagem iremos conhecer novas tags.

Tags básicas para Fonte e Texto

Itálico:  <i>texto</i>
Sublinhado<u>texto</u>
Negrito<b>texto</b>
Texto Riscado: <s>texto</s>
Centralizar<center>texto</center>
Alinhar texto à esquerda: <p align="left">texto</p>
Alinhar texto à direita<p align="right">texto</p>
Mudar cor do texto<font color="red">texto</font>
Mudar a fonte<font face="Arial">texto</font>
Mudar o tamanho: <font size="2">texto</font>
Novo Parágrafo<p>texto</p> 
Esta tag inicia um novo parágrafo deixando uma linha em branco entre o novo parágrafo e o parágrafo anterior.
Quebra de linha: <br>
Esta tag faz com que o texto que vier a seguir mude para a linha seguinte.Colocando esta tag duas vezes seguidas faz o  efeito de uma tag de parágrafo.

Inserir imagem 

Para inserir uma imagem usa se a tag <img src="imagem.jpg">.
Coloca a pasta onde a imagem está.Ex: <img src="pasta/imagem.jpg"- abre a imagem
Em seguida coloque o nome da imagem e o formato dela.

Definir Altura e Largura

Para definir a largura usa-se "width". Para definir a altura usa-se "height". 
<img src="imagem.jpg" width="300" height="150"> 

 Contorno da Imagem

Para colocar contorno na imagem usa-se "border". <img src="imagem.jpg" border="5"> 
Se você colocar border=0, a imagem não terá contorno. Sendo assim, quanto mais elevado o valor atribuido a border, maior ficará a espessura do contorno da imagem

Criar tabelas

Tags para inserir tabelas básicas:
<table>: tag para inicializar e finalizar uma tabela.
<tr>: tag para inserir uma linha.
<td>: tag para inserir uma coluna.
Exemplo de uma tabela simples:
<table border="3">
<tr>   <td>1º célula</td> <td>2º célula</td> <td> 3º célula</td>   </tr>
<tr>   <td> 4º célula</td> <td> 5º célula</td> <td>6º célula</td>   </tr>
</table>
e o resultado é:

1º célula2º célula3º célula
4º célula5º célula6ºcélula

Nessa postagem conhecemos o HTML um pouco mais a fundo, aprendemos a criar tabelas, inserir imagem e modificar texto. 

Ter ou não ter? Eis a questão...

Desde a época das cavernas o homem vem desenvolvendo e aprimorando ferramentas para facilitar a vida. Antes da Revolução Industrial, os homens eram forçados a testar sua capacidade física para serem adequados aos trabalhos que deviam realizar. Mas após o ocorrido, quase todo o trabalho manual passou a ser industrializado pela criação de máquinas que faziam melhor e de modo mais eficiente o trabalho que seria realizado por um ou mais homens. 

Com o passar dos anos, cada vez mais as máquinas ganharam espaço e investimento, e com o desenvolvimento da tecnologia expandido a um ritmo intenso e acelerado, fica cada vez mais presente a questão: Será que as máquinas substituirão de vez os homens? Até que ponto toda a tecnologia existente nos ajuda? O excesso de tecnologia pode nos atrapalhar? E se, num futuro não muito distante, as máquinas, robôs, etc., estiverem em número maior ou igual ao nosso, teremos então uma Revolução das Máquinas?

Desde que a tecnologia está presente em nossas vidas, vem abrindo espaço e despertando o interesse na mente de muitos escritores, roteiristas, e pessoas que apenas gostam de opinar. Sendo assim, há ao redor do mundo diversos livros e filmes sobre o assunto. Como: Eu, Robô, A.I – Inteligência Artificial, Blade Runner, Wall-E, entre outros.

Em Blade Runner, por exemplo, em 2019 a Terra está cheia de “replicantes”, seres geneticamente modificados, com aparência física praticamente idêntica a humana, descritos como “mais humanos do que os humanos”, porém são mais ágeis e fortes, agressivos e emocionalmente instáveis, levando a um ponto onde representam perigo aos humanos, havendo assim a proibição de sua existência. Os que sobram são caçados, e ao decorrer do filme os replicantes exibem cada vez mais características humanas, enquanto os humanos tomam atitudes cada vez mais desumanas. No fim, a mesma questão que preocupa os replicantes, acaba sendo motivo de preocupação para os humanos. 


Há mais de dez anos robôs já vêm sendo utilizados com fins de guerra e espionagem. Os Estados Unidos possuem um amplo leque de tecnologia avançada, devido ao seu alto investimento. Eles utilizam, por exemplo, aviões não tripulados, que podem ser controlados dos EUA, robôs usados para desarmar bombas a distância, prevenindo assim maiores danos aos soldados, e ao redor do mundo, já existem diversos laboratórios focados em criar robôs autônomos com a função de irem para futuras guerras, com chips que permitem a capacidade de se regenerarem ao sofrer algum dano, altamente equipados com armas de fogo, e inteligência para maior eficácia ao atacarem um alvo, tendo em vista causar o maior estrago possível. Não vai demorar muito tempo para que as coisas retratadas nesses filmes possam realmente acontecer. Cada vez mais o homem vem perdendo espaço para inovações tecnológicas. O que nos leva a pensar sobre a possibilidade de acabarmos como no filme Wall-e.

A animação da parceria Disney-Pixar, conta a história do planeta sem condições de ser habitado, restando apenas um robô e uma barata. Até que uma sonda mandada do espaço, onde agora vivem os humanos, chega para constatar se há ou não a possibilidade de voltar para a Terra. Após ficar amiga do robô, esse a mostra uma pequena planta, achada crescendo entre o lixo, e ela a leva para a nave, Axiom, onde os humanos se encontram num estado de obesidade mórbida e completamente dependentes dos sistemas automáticos da nave. 



O filme culpa o consumismo em massa desenfreado pelo estado em que as coisas chegaram. Se compararmos a realidade de hoje, não é impossível imaginar isso acontecendo. Toda a tecnologia existente traz suas vantagens, como a facilidade em realizar nossas tarefas cotidianas, e até certa comodidade, afinal, graças a internet você não precisa sair de casa para praticamente nada, você pode se comunicar através dela, fazer compras, pagar contas, assistir filmes... Porém, toda essa facilidade pode gerar um comodismo nada saudável, e embora seja feito para aumentar nossos benefícios, o uso desenfreado pode acarretar dependência e nos transformar em alienados, preguiçosos e incapazes de desenvolver uma linha de pensamento. 

A tecnologia hoje é indispensável e crucial para a realização de diversas tarefas, e sem dúvidas um adianto nas nossas vidas. A questão é: Seremos capazes de estabelecer um limite? Ou acabaremos reféns das nossas próprias criações? 





O que é CSS3?

O Cascading Style Sheets (CSS) é uma "folha de estilo" composta por “camadas” e utilizada para definir a apresentação (aparência) nas páginas da internet que adotam para o seu desenvolvimento linguagens de marcação (como XML, HTML e XHTML). O CSS define como serão exibidos os  código de uma página da internet ,e sua maior vantagem é efetuar a separação entre o formato e o conteúdo de um documento.


Segue esse exemplo criado no bloco de notas e logo abaixo iremos mostrar a imagem já como página de web.

A página aberta no navegador.



Na próxima postagem sobre CSS3 iremos conhecer um pouco mais sobre ele. Aguardem !